"Organiser" and "organizer" mean someone who arranges an event or activity and differ only in spelling: "organiser" (British) and "organizer" (American).
Difference Between Organiser and Organizer
Diving into the words "organiser" and "organizer," the primary distinction that becomes evident is the variance in spelling which adheres to different regional English conventions. "Organiser" is utilized within the realms of British English, frequently used in areas that align with British English usage, such as the United Kingdom, Australia, and other similar regions. Meanwhile, "organizer" is engraved within American English, aligning with the linguistic norms prevalent in the United States and associated territories.

Both "organiser" and "organizer," despite their spelling differences, encapsulate the same meaning and applications. An organiser or an organizer typically refers to a person, or sometimes a thing (like a diary or an app), that brings about coordination and arrangement in a structured manner. For instance, coordinating events, managing tasks, or orchestrating activities, all come under the purview of what an organiser or an organizer would do, irrespective of the specific spelling used.
